Pascal. Циклы. Задача 3

Составить программу для вычисления значений функции f=7*sin(x^2)-0.5*cosx на отрезке [a; b] с шагом h. Результат представить в виде таблицы, первый столбец которой – значения аргумента, второй – соответствующие значения функции.

Решение:

program cycles_3;
uses crt;
var
f, h, a, b: real;
begin
clrscr;
write(' Введите a: '); read(a);
write(' Введите b: '); read(b);
write(' Введите h: '); read(h);
write(' Шаг Значение');
writeln;
while (a<=b) do
begin
f:=7*sin(sqr(a))-0.5*cos(a);
writeln(a:3:0, f:11:3);
a:=a+h;
end;
readkey;
end.

 

Рейтинг
( Пока оценок нет )
Загрузка ...